Ep. 203 - 12 Traits of People Who Pass Special Forces Selection

Over the years, I’ve noticed that successful SFAS candidates tend to approach their training and preparation in very similar ways. Here is what they do in common: 00:15 – Intro – 02:04 – Trait #1 – High carbohydrate intake to fuel training and recovery 06:56 – Trait #2 – Identify and address personal character flaws 15:31 – Trait #3 – Autoregulation 22:23 – Trait #4 – Prioritizing sleep with the “big three” habits 33:36 – Trait #5 – Preparing meals ahead of time 35:48 – Trait #6 – Balanced strength training 41:21 – Trait #7 – Regular loaded carries 43:37 – Trait #8 – Controlled weekly run frequency with strategic cross-training 45:22 – Trait #9 – Structured weekly training split 46:11 – Trait #10 – Tracking metrics (macros, training progress) 49:48 – Trait #11 – Restricting or eliminating social media during prep 52:12 – Trait #12 – Focusing on the process over the outcome — Questions?
